Establishing a Rural Sanctuary and Family Legacy

Jennifer and Chris Swindle have strong ties to the rural lifestyle. Having grown up in rural Tennessee and Georgia respectively, they share fond memories of their childhoods and the freedom that came along with it. It’s no surprise that, after years of living in a suburban neighborhood, they longed to reconnect with their rural roots and find a home where their children could experience the same upbringing. 

The Swindles’ search for their perfect property was frustrating—until fate intervened. As a lawyer, Jennifer discovered historic land in Knox County, Tennessee through her legal work. Built in 1899, the property sits on a serene lake, with ample space for the family’s outdoor lifestyle. As a contractor, Chris admires the quality craftsmanship; from the intricate crown molding to every bedroom’s lake view. The property’s rich history, once home to a therapeutic horseback riding nonprofit, only deepened their connection to it.

Swindle family enjoys a walk from the lake

The land has become a sanctuary for their family. “Mornings bring the sunrise as we cook, and the sunset as we wind down—it’s as close to heaven as you can get,” Chris said. Jennifer and Chris shared that their children enjoy their newfound freedom outdoors and are outside making memories rather than reading about them. “They're much more confident in who they are,” Jennifer said. “What matters to us most is family and leaving a legacy.”
